The AI ecosystem is undergoing a profound structural shift from speculative token maxing to operational token scarcity, characterized by unprecedented capital deployment, supply chain diversification, and aggressive geopolitical restructuring. SpaceX's historic initial public offering, priced at a staggering $1.8 trillion valuation with over $100 billion in retail orders, underscores a severe disconnect between market enthusiasm and fundamental revenue metrics, as the company reported a $5 billion operating loss on $18.7 billion in revenue. This event establishes a volatile precedent for upcoming AI infrastructure valuations, while Goldman Sachs has simultaneously revised 2027 AI capital expenditure forecasts upward to a baseline of $1.1 trillion and a bullish scenario of $1.4 trillion. This revision is driven by projections of 24x token consumption growth through 2030, fueled by the widespread deployment of agentic workloads, directly contradicting conservative consensus estimates and signaling that infrastructure demand remains robust despite efficiency narratives.
Strategic Shifts in Token Economics and Enterprise Adoption
Market narratives suggesting an imminent demand collapse based on declining token price indices are fundamentally misaligned with underlying enterprise data. The Silicon Data LLM Token Expenditure Index, often misinterpreted as a measure of volume or total spend, actually tracks the weighted average price per million tokens via third-party routers designed explicitly for cost optimization. This metric reflects a rationalization toward token efficiency as enterprises transition from assisted to agentic use cases, necessitating mixed-model strategies and rigorous budget management. Crucially, data from Ramp indicates that median AI spend across businesses remains at a mere $11.38 per employee per month, revealing massive untapped adoption potential. In contrast, the top 1% of AI-intensive firms spend approximately $7,500 per employee, demonstrating that current efficiency gains will be dwarfed by the exponential expansion of total AI consumption as the broader market scales adoption.
Infrastructure Integration, Supply Chain Resilience, and Geopolitical Risks
Physical constraints are driving significant structural changes in global supply chains and capital allocation strategies. Persistent backlogs at TSMC are compelling hyperscalers like Google to diversify manufacturing processes, integrating Samsung components for memory input-output dies and Intel for advanced packaging, thereby creating a more fragmented but resilient ecosystem. In response to deployment bottlenecks, private equity and sovereign wealth entities are pursuing vertical integration; KKR and NVIDIA's $10 billion Helix Digital Infrastructure venture aims to unify capital, chip deployment, and power generation under a single entity to accelerate data center construction. Geopolitical tensions are simultaneously reshaping the industry landscape. Beijing's forced unwinding of Meta's Manus acquisition has triggered a chilling effect, prompting Chinese AI startups to abandon "red-chip" structures and reincorporate domestically, signaling severe restrictions on cross-border capital and talent mobility. Furthermore, Prometheus AI's $41 billion valuation and strategy to launch a $100 billion fund for industrial buyouts illustrate the expansion of AI capital into the physical economy, acquiring factories to secure proprietary manufacturing data while challenging traditional labor market assumptions.
